Dining

On-site restaurants

TOKI

An innovative Kyoto-French restaurant led by an award-winning chef, serving creative and refined cuisine.

FORNI

This Italian restaurant offers a modern space with grilled dishes and authentic pizzas, inspired by the seasonal flavors of Japan.

THE GARDEN BAR

A bar and lounge with stunning garden views, offering a sophisticated setting for drinks from day to night.

Honest review

What could be better

  • The hotel needs to significantly improve its staff training and service consistency, as guests reported rude and unhelpful front desk staff and a general lack of professional hospitality.
  • Management should re-evaluate the value for money, as guests felt the high price was not justified by the limited amenities and service, and some experienced confusing and restrictive dress codes that weren't consistently enforced.
  • The hotel needs to address operational issues and amenities, including ensuring a more efficient check-in process and providing better views for rooms and stronger appliances like hair dryers.

Frequently asked

Is Hotel the Mitsui Kyoto a luxury collection hotel?+

Yes, the hotel is part of the Marriott Bonvoy Luxury Collection.

Does Hotel the Mitsui Kyoto have a restaurant?+

Yes, the hotel has multiple restaurants including TOKI, FORNI, YUI, and THE GARDEN BAR.

What kind of breakfast is served at HOTEL THE MITSUI KYOTO, a Luxury Collection Hotel & Spa?+

The hotel offers Japanese and Western breakfast options, including a buffet and an à la carte menu.

What are the check-in and check-out times at HOTEL THE MITSUI KYOTO, a Luxury Collection Hotel & Spa?+

Check-in is at 3:00 PM and check-out is at 12:00 PM.
